Abstract
In the present paper initial problems for the semilinear integro-differential diffusion equation and system are considered. The analogue of Duhamel principle for the linear integro-differential diffusion equation is proved. The results on existence of local mild solutions and Fujita-type critical exponents to the semilinear integro-differential diffusion equation and system are presented.
